Arizona State University is proud to present our 5th camp in 2011, which will be in mid July. Camp will take place at the ACA accredited YMCA's Camp Chauncey Ranch in Mayer, AZ. This 5000-acre ranch on the Agua Fria river has close to 100 horses, 50 head of cattle, a few goats and enough bunks for 150 “ranch hands.” The Ranch has cottonwood trees, willows, green pastures, sports field, and a NEW two-acre lake. Chauncey Ranch comes fully equipped with an 800-ft. zipline, climbing tower, swimming, archery, ropes course, team challenges, canoeing, and campfires. These events are all hosted by the YMCA's staff who are trained and certified in hosting these activities. Along with the events made available through the YMCA, activities in sports, art, drama, and nature will be integrated into the daily schedule.

                                     

Since camper safety and security is our number one priority, Camp Kesem ASU will be staffed with a nurse and social worker. Counselors are thoroughly trained before camp following National guidelines. Leadership is divided between our camp director and the administration team. Camp Kesem's National Programming Director will also be in attendance for a portion of camp. Consistent with National guidelines, ASU follows a 2-to-1 camper to counselor ratio.
